Output 95fbe318776d380cadb2fb5232578f97d051b6e46d94a130a8ceb02c0e04d19d:1

value
5803616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569ce43eab8d06ded9827025636f98660bb9197e OP_EQUAL
address
39ayz4PtRtAxkimgbPcQq6y6qaVKLJY7GK
transaction
95fbe318776d380cadb2fb5232578f97d051b6e46d94a130a8ceb02c0e04d19d
spent
true